GILBERT, AZ — Alamo Drafthouse announced Tuesday its plans to open a dine-in movie theater in Gilbert, its third cinema in the East Valley.

According to the online announcement, the theater will be have eight auditoriums with reserved seating, laser and digital 4K projection, and the ability to order food and drinks while watching a movie.

There will also be a bar in the lobby with 30 local and regional beers, the announcement said.

"We're thrilled to be in the beginning stages of our third Alamo location in the Phoenix area," said Derek Dodd, operating partner for Alamo Phoenix, in a written statement.

The 38,512-square-foot theater will be built off Power Road, between Ray and Williams Field road. It is slated to open by the end of the year.

The Texas-based theater chain opened its first theater in Chandler, Arizona in 2016. Two years later, a second cinema opened at "The Collective" development in Tempe.

What about the West Valley? In a phone interview with ABC15, Dodd said the team does have their future sights set on the western part of the Valley, even parts of central Phoenix. "Our plan has been to expand throughout Arizona, " he said.

It is not known how many locations Alamo plans to have in the Valley total. However, Dodd said the team is "absolutely aware" of those asking for locations in other places. "We definitely have plans to go to the west side," he added.
